Subject: Re: [PATCH] HID: roccat: Removing all modules except Kone

On Thu, 16 Apr 2015, Stefan Achatz wrote:

> This patch removes all roccat hid modules except the one for the first Kone.
> 
> Package roccat-tools is the only known user of these modules. Starting with
> roccat-tools-2.2.0, released 7 months ago, I'm not using these modules
> anymore. All functionality has been moved to userspace using hidraw.

7 months means 2 or 3 major kernel releases, and no depreciation process 
has happened.

Could you please work on more user-friendly depreciation plan for these 
drivers?
